## Environment Variables — SpoolPilot Print Service

SpoolPilot, the printer-spooler microservice maintained by the Quarrow platform team, reads all runtime configuration from its environment at startup. `SPOOL_QUEUE_DEPTH` and `SPOOL_RETRY_MAX` are non-sensitive and may appear in plaintext manifests. The broker credential, however, must never be committed to the repo and is injected only via the deployment env file. That file must contain exactly one line setting the broker secret, as follows:

sealed setting: LEDGER_TOKEN5=bcca1

Changed defaults — Merrowline dedupe service, v4.2. The fuzzy-match threshold was raised after false merges in the Ostenfeld dataset, and phonetic matching now defaults off for non-Latin scripts. Merge candidates below the threshold are queued for manual review rather than auto-merged. Future maintainers should note these defaults were tuned deliberately; see the decision log before changing them. Current values:

config for kafof-bawef:
holath:
  log_level: debug
  metrics_host: metrics.holath.qorvelsys.internal
  pin: 2191
  pool_size: 32

During weekend lift maintenance at Ashgrove House, contractors must use Stairwell B and sign in at the loading dock before starting work. The goods lift remains available until 10:00 Saturday only. Stairwell B's lower door locks automatically behind you; to re-enter from the dock, use the code below.

staff pass of kawip-hawef = bdg-QLP-2